EASY GREEK MEATBALLS



Easy Greek meatballs image

Juicy Greek meatballs made with beef, lamb and feta cheese is a delicious, easy recipe perfect for lunch, dinner or as an appetizer served with yogurt.

500 g (1lb) ground/minced lamb
500 g (1lb) ground/minced beef
1 cup fresh breadcrumbs
2 large eggs
½ cup feta cheese (crumbled)
1 small red onion (finely minced )
2 garlic cloves (crushed )
zest of 1 lemon
3 tsp dried oregano
2 tsp rosemary (finely chopped)
½ cup parsley (finely chopped)
2 tsp salt
1-2 tsp black pepper

Steps:

  • Combine all the ingredients and mix until the ingredients are just combined, taking care not to over mix (this can cause the meatballs to be very dense).
  • To mix the meatballs: With wet hands (this prevents the meat from sticking to your hands), form meatballs of approximately 3cm/1in and place on a chopping board.
  • To fry the meatballs: pre-heat a non-stick frying pan and add a tablespoon of olive oil. Fry the meatballs in batches until golden brown on both sides and cooked through.
  • To bake the meatballs: Pre-heat the oven to 220ºC. Line 2 baking sheets with baking/parchment paper and add the meatballs, keeping some space between them. Drizzle the meatballs with 1-2 tbsp olive oil and place in the oven. Allow to bake, turning over halfway, until golden brown and cooked through (approximately 20-30 minutes).
  • Remove the meatballs from the heat, drizzle with lemon juice (optional) and serve.

FETA AND OLIVE MEATBALLS



Feta and Olive Meatballs image

These baked, ground lamb meatballs are flavored with feta and green olives.

1 pound ground lamb
½ cup chopped fresh parsley
2 tablespoons finely chopped onion
½ cup crumbled feta cheese
½ cup chopped green olives
2 eggs
1 teaspoon Italian seasoning

Steps:

  • Preheat your oven's broiler.
  • In a large bowl, mix together ground lamb with parsley, onion, feta cheese, green olives, eggs, and Italian seasoning. Shape into 16 meatballs, and place 2 inches apart on a baking sheet.
  • Broil about 3 inches away from the heat until browned on top. Turn over, and broil on the other side.

GREEK MEATBALLS, FETA YOGURT SAUCE AND LEMON COUSCOUS



Greek Meatballs, Feta Yogurt Sauce and Lemon Couscous image

Yummy, a whole different way to eat meatballs. No Italian sauce, but a creamy Feta sauce and lemon couscous to serve everything over versus pasta. It really is great and honestly doesn't take long. Couscous as you know takes 5 minutes. I make the dressing ahead and you are only left with the meatballs which you can actually make ahead, refrigerate or freeze and then make later. A salad on the side with a lemon vinaigrette and fresh tomatoes and dinner. Can't get much easier. Give it a try, you will love it if you enjoy greek flavors like me.

1/2 cup feta cheese
1/2 cup plain yogurt
1/8 cup half-and-half
3 tablespoons lemon juice
salt (go easy, feta is salty)
pepper
3/4 cup couscous
3/4 cup chicken broth
1/4 cup lemon juice (fresh)
salt
pepper
1 tablespoon olive oil
1/2 lb ground lamb
1/2 ground beef
1/4 cup feta cheese
1/4 cup milk
1/4 cup parsley
2 scallions, diced fine (white and green parts)
salt
pepper
2 teaspoons dried oregano
1 large egg
2 tablespoons olive oil, to saute
3/4 cup kalamata olive (cut in half)
1 tablespoon minced garlic
1 teaspoon red pepper flakes
3 (15 ounce) cans diced tomatoes, just plain no seasoning
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1 teaspoon fresh parsley
1 cup diced cucumber
1 lemon, sliced

Steps:

  • Sauce -- Mix the feta, yogurt, half and half, salt and pepper and lemon juice. Set to the side in a small bowl and refrigerate. Done!
  • Couscous -- As I said takes literally 5 minutes to boil, stir in couscous and it's done. Don't worry about that until the dinner is done. Although you can put a pot on the stove with the broth, lemon juice, olive oil, salt and pepper and put the couscous in a measuring cup on the side, just so it is all ready.
  • Cucumber and Lemon -- Now I use a English (or seedless cucumber and just dice it up and set to the side (it's done). Same with slicing the lemon. One less thing to do at the end of the meal.
  • Meatballs -- Simply in a large bowl, add the feta, milk, parsley, scallions, egg, oregano, salt and pepper. I mix everything well and then add the meat last. You don't want to over mix the meat as it can make it tough. Just mix enough to be combined. Roll into golf ball size meatballs.
  • Saute -- Just heat up the olive oil in a large saute pan on medium high and cook them until golden brown. Remove to a plate while you make the sauce.
  • Sauce -- In the same pan with the drippings from the meatballs, add the olives, garlic and red pepper and cook just a minute. then stir in the tomatoes, oregano and parsley and cook just another minute to heat up. Add the meatballs back in to finish cooking. They will take approximately 5-10 minutes depending on the size. Just keep them on a low simmer.
  • Couscous -- As the meatballs finish, cook the couscous. Just bring the broth, lemon, olive oil and seasoning up to a boil. Add the couscous, stir and remove from the heat and cover. Use foil, a lid, saran wrap, a plate, or anything you have will work just fine. Just let it set for 5 minutes and it is done.
  • Serve -- Use a fork to fluff the couscous and then just spoon some on your plate. Top with 2-3 of the meatballs and some of the tomato and olive sauce, and now the good part. Finish with a spoon of the yogurt sauce over the meatballs and some diced cucumber and then squeeze the lemon.
  • And trust me -- now you have a totally amazing dish.

GREEK FETA AND OLIVE MEATBALLS



Greek Feta and Olive Meatballs image

This quick and easy recipe--prepares in less than 10 minutes and cooks in about 5--is so full of flavor. Ground lamb, feta, green olives and fresh herbs make a culinary explosion in you month. Place them on top jasmine rice.

1 lb ground lamb
1/2 cup chopped fresh parsley
2 tablespoons finely chopped onions
1/2 cup crumbled feta cheese
1/2 cup chopped green olives
1/4 cup chopped black olives
2 eggs
1 1/2 teaspoons italian seasoning

Steps:

  • Preheat oven's broiler.
  • Mix all the ingredients in large bowl.
  • Shape into medium sized meatballs--no bigger then a golf ball.
  • Place the meatballs two inches apart on a baking sheet.
  • Broil about 3 inches away from heat until they are golden brown on the top, about 3 to 4 minutes depending on the size of the meatball.
  • Turn the ball over and broil the other side.
  • Best served on Mediterranean jasmine rice or with cheese crackers and wine, a nice merlot.
